Registered Dietician

JOB SUMMARY  

Assesses nutritional status of PACE participants. Uses pertinent data to plan and implement appropriate nutrition interventions and communicate the information to the Interdisciplinary Team to ensure the nutritional needs of the participants are met. Functions as a member of the Interdisciplinary Team. Provides nutrition counseling, education, and therapy to participants; educates and counsels family and other caregivers regarding dietary issues; and conducts initial assessments and periodic reassessments.  Participates in the development of the plan of care, assists in the coordination of 24-hour care delivery, and regularly informs the Interdisciplinary Team (IDT) of the nutritional needs of each participant. Provides education to other health care professionals as appropriate.
